Gross rental yield is annual rent divided by purchase price, before expenses. It does not account for vacancy rates, management fees, maintenance, or financing costs. Use this as a starting point for further research.

Offence Summary

LGA-wide data, not suburb-specific

NT Police only publishes crime statistics at the local government area / region level. The numbers below cover the entire Darwin, which may include suburbs with very different crime profiles. Quieter residential pockets within the LGA likely have lower rates than the total suggests; busier areas may have higher.
